  • In this video, we're exploring the top 10 foods for unclogging arteries and reducing the risk of heart attacks, essential for anyone prioritizing heart health. From fatty fish rich in omega-3 fatty acids to oats with their cholesterol-lowering beta-glucans, we delve into each food's unique cardiovascular benefits. Nuts, berries, and dark chocolate offer antioxidants and healthy fats, while olive oil contributes to maintaining cholesterol levels. Legumes provide fiber and protein for heart health, and garlic is lauded for its blood pressure-reducing properties. Leafy greens and avocados round out the list with their nutrient-packed profiles.
